在当今数字化时代,网站已成为企业和个人展示自身形象、推广产品或服务的重要平台。因此,掌握搭建网站的专业技能不仅有助于个人能力的提升,还能为求职增添一份有力的筹码。那么,究竟需要学习哪些专业知识才能更好地搭建网站并顺利找到相关工作呢?本文将为您揭晓答案。

一、前端开发技术

1. HTML/CSS/JavaScript:这是构建网站的基础语言。HTML负责网页的结构,CSS用于美化页面,而JavaScript则负责实现网页的动态效果和交互功能。掌握这三门技术,您就能独立完成一个静态网站的搭建。

2. 响应式设计:随着移动设备的普及,网站需要在不同设备上都能良好显示。学习响应式设计,可以使您的网站适应各种屏幕尺寸,提升用户体验。

3. 前端框架:如React、Vue等。这些框架提供了更高效的开发方式,可以让您快速构建出功能强大且易于维护的网站。

二、后端开发技术

1. 服务器端语言:如Python、Java、PHP等。掌握一门服务器端语言,您可以处理网站的数据逻辑,实现用户注册、登录、数据存储等功能。

2. 数据库管理:学习如何设计、优化和管理数据库,对于搭建网站至关重要。常用的数据库有MySQL、PostgreSQL等。

3. API接口开发:前后端分离的开发模式下,API接口是连接前端和后端的关键。掌握API的开发和测试,可以提高网站的可扩展性和可维护性。

三、全栈开发能力

除了前端和后端的专业知识外,全栈开发能力也是当前市场非常看重的技能。全栈开发者能够独立完成网站从设计到部署的全过程,具有更高的竞争力。

四、版本控制工具

如Git。在团队协作中,版本控制工具可以帮助您更好地管理代码,跟踪代码的变更历史,便于团队成员之间的协作。

五、持续集成与持续部署(CI/CD)

了解并掌握CI/CD工具,如Jenkins、Travis CI等,可以自动化地完成代码的构建、测试和部署过程,提高开发效率。

六、SEO优化

搜索引擎优化(SEO)是提高网站在搜索引擎中排名的技术。通过学习SEO,您可以使您的网站更容易被用户发现,从而带来更多的流量和潜在客户。

想要通过搭建网站技能找到好工作,您需要系统地学习前端开发技术、后端开发技术、全栈开发能力、版本控制工具、CI/CD以及SEO优化等专业知识。当然,除了理论知识的学习外,实践经验的积累也是非常重要的。通过不断地实践和项目经验的积累,您将能够更加熟练地运用这些知识,并在求职中脱颖而出。